信息安全产品配置与应用(基于华为防火墙)课件 04-双机热备技术_第1页
信息安全产品配置与应用(基于华为防火墙)课件 04-双机热备技术_第2页
信息安全产品配置与应用(基于华为防火墙)课件 04-双机热备技术_第3页
信息安全产品配置与应用(基于华为防火墙)课件 04-双机热备技术_第4页
信息安全产品配置与应用(基于华为防火墙)课件 04-双机热备技术_第5页
已阅读5页,还剩40页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

模块4双机热备技术

在当今信息化时代,网络已成为企业运营不可或缺的基础设施。然而,网络中断的风险时刻存在,一旦发生,不仅可能导致业务运营的中断,还可能带来数据丢失等严重后果。为了有效应对这一挑战,双机热备技术应运而生并逐渐成为网络架构中的关键一环。

本章将详细介绍双机热备技术的基础知识、工作原理、组网模型、故障监控和切换等内容,帮助读者全面了解并掌握这一重要技术。引入【知识目标】

了解双机热备的系统要求和工作模式。

理解双机热备的工作原理和组网模型。

了解双机热备故障监控和切换的触发条件及切换行为。【技能目标】

掌握双机热备主备备份典型组网的配置方法。

掌握双机热备负载分担典型组网的配置方法。【素养目标】

培养团结协作、互补互助的团队意识。

培养灵活应变、沉着冷静的危机处置能力。目标content目

录01双机热备的基础知识02双机热备的工作原理03双机热备的组网模型04故障监控和切换01双机热备的基础知识1.双机热备简介

双机热备技术是一种通过部署两台防火墙设备,实现主备切换,以提高网络可靠性和安全性的技术。具体来说,这两台防火墙设备在硬件和软件配置上完全相同,它们通过一条独立的链路连接,这条链路通常被称为心跳线,用于实时监测对方的工作状态、同步配置信息(如安全策略、NAT策略、带宽管理等)以及状态信息(如会话表等)。当一台防火墙出现故障时,业务流量能平滑地切换到另一台防火墙上进行处理,保障业务的连续性。双机热备的基础知识012.双机热备的系统要求

组成双机热备的两台防火墙对设备硬件、软件以及License等都有严格的要求。

硬件要求组成双机热备的两台防火墙的型号必须相同。安装的单板类型、数量及单板安装的位置必须相同。对于特定型号(如USG6680E和USG6712E/6716E),要求组成双机热备的两台同型号设备的BomIDVersion匹配。两台防火墙的硬盘配置可以不同。例如,若一台防火墙安装硬盘,另一台防火墙不安装硬盘,并不会影响双机热备的运行。双机热备的基础知识012.双机热备的系统要求

组成双机热备的两台防火墙对设备硬件、软件以及License等都有严格的要求。

软件要求组成双机热备的两台防火墙的系统软件版本、系统补丁版本、动态加载的组件包、特征库版本必须相同。Hash选择中央处理器(CentralProcessingUnit,CPU)模式以及Hash因子必须相同。在系统软件版本升级或回退的过程中,两台防火墙可以暂时运行不同版本的系统软件。双机热备的基础知识012.双机热备的系统要求

组成双机热备的两台防火墙对设备硬件、软件以及License等都有严格的要求。License要求双机热备功能自身不需要额外的License。对于其他需要License的功能,如IPS、反病毒等功能,组成双机热备的两台防火墙需要分别申请和加载License。两台防火墙之间不能共享License。两台防火墙的License控制项种类、资源数量、升级服务到期时间都要相同。双机热备的基础知识013.双机热备的工作模式

在主备备份模式下,两台防火墙设备一主一备。正常情况下,业务流量全部由主设备处理,备份设备不处理业务流量,但会同步主设备的会话表及Server-map表等关键数据。当主设备发生故障时,备份设备能够立即接管业务流量,保证业务不中断。双机热备的基础知识01(1)主备备份模式3.双机热备的工作模式

在负载分担模式下,两台防火墙设备互为主备。正常情况下,两台设备共同负载整网的业务流量。当其中一台设备发生故障时,另一台设备会负载其业务,保证原本通过该设备转发的业务不中断。

负载分担模式适用于业务流量较大,需要两台设备同时分担流量的场景。双机热备的基础知识01(2)负载分担模式02双机热备的工作原理1.VRRP

虚拟路由器冗余协议(VirtualRouterRedundancyProtocol,VRRP)是一种容错协议,其保证了当主机的下一跳路由器(默认网关)出现故障时,由备份路由器自动代替出现故障的路由器完成报文转发任务,从而保持网络通信的连续性和可靠性。双机热备的工作原理02(1)VRRP简介1.VRRP

VRRP备份组有3种状态:Initialize、Master和Backup。

Initialize:初始化状态。当设备的VRRP备份组状态为Initialize时,表示该VRRP备份组处于不可用状态。

Master:活动状态。VRRP备份组状态为Master的设备被称为主设备。主设备拥有VRRP备份组的虚拟IP地址和虚拟MAC地址。当主设备收到目的IP地址是虚拟IP地址的ARP请求时,会响应该ARP请求。

Backup:备份状态。VRRP备份组状态为Backup的设备被称为备份设备。备份设备不会响应目的IP地址为虚拟IP地址的ARP请求。双机热备的工作原理02(2)VRRP备份组状态1.VRRP

在VRRP备份组中,主备路由器选举成功后,主路由器会发送免费ARP报文,将VRRP备份组的虚拟MAC地址和虚拟IP地址宣告给与其连接的交换机,下行的交换机的MAC表项会记录虚拟MAC地址与GE0/0/1接口的对应关系。双机热备的工作原理02(3)VRRP工作原理1.VRRP

当主路由器发生故障时,备份路由器会切换为主路由器,新的主路由器会立即发送携带VRRP备份组虚拟MAC地址和虚拟IP地址信息的免费ARP报文,刷新与其连接的下行交换机的MAC表项。下行交换机的MAC表项会记录虚拟MAC地址与GE0/0/2接口的对应关系。双机热备的工作原理02(3)VRRP工作原理1.VRRP

当原主路由器故障恢复后,如果配置了抢占功能,则原主路由器会抢占为主路由器;如果没有配置抢占功能,则原主路由器将仍然保持为Backup状态。双机热备的工作原理02(3)VRRP工作原理1.VRRP双机热备的工作原理02(4)多VRRP备份组存在的问题

当一台设备上配置多VRRP备份组时,由于VRRP备份组之间是相互独立的,因此它们之间的状态无法同步。2.VGMP

VGMP是华为的私有协议,其中定义了VGMP组。每台防火墙都有一个VGMP组,用户不能删除该VGMP组,也不能再创建其他VGMP组。VGMP组有4种状态:Initialize、Load-balance、Active和Standby。其中,Initialize是初始化状态,设备未启用双机热备功能时,VGMP组就处于该状态。其他3种状态是设备通过比较自身和对端设备VGMP组优先级大小确定的。设备通过心跳线接收对端设备的VGMP报文,了解对端设备的VGMP组优先级。双机热备的工作原理02(1)VGMP简介2.VGMP

当设备自身的VGMP组优先级等于对端设备的VGMP组优先级时,设备的VGMP组状态为Load-balance。

当设备自身的VGMP组优先级大于对端设备的VGMP组优先级时,设备的VGMP组状态为Active。

当设备自身的VGMP组优先级小于对端设备的VGMP组优先级时,设备的VGMP组状态为Standby。

当设备没有接收到对端设备的VGMP报文,无法了解到对端VGMP组优先级时,设备的VGMP组状态为Active。双机热备的工作原理02(1)VGMP简介2.VGMP

防火墙上所有的VRRP备份组都加入VGMP组中,由VGMP组集中监控并管理所有的VRRP备份组状态。

接口出现故障时,接口下VRRP备份组的状态为Initialize;接口无故障时,接口下VRRP备份组状态由VGMP组的状态决定,具体如下。

当VGMP组状态为Active时,VRRP备份组的状态都是Master。

当VGMP组状态为Standby时,VRRP备份组的状态都是Backup。

当VGMP组状态为Load-balance时,VRRP备份组状态由VRRP备份组的配置决定。双机热备的工作原理02(2)VGMP组控制VRRP备份组状态2.VGMP

开启双机热备功能后,防火墙能根据VGMP组状态动态调整OSPF/OSPFv3发布路由的开销值和BGP发布路由的MED值。具体如下:

VGMP组状态为Active时,防火墙按照OSPF/OSPFv3/BGP路由的配置正常发布路由。VGMP组状态为Standby时,防火墙会按照如下方法调整OSPF/OSPFv3发布路由的开销值和BGP发布路由的MED值。OSPF/OSPFv3:将OSPF/OSPFv3协议发布路由的开销值调整为一个指定数值,默认将开销值调整为65500,可以使用“hrpadjustospf-cost/ospfv3-costenableslave-cost”命令修改该数值。BGP:在用户配置的BGPMED值的基础上增加一定数值作为BGP发布路由时的MED值,默认增加的数值为100,可以使用“hrpadjustbgp-costenableslave-cost”命令修改该数值。双机热备的工作原理02(3)VGMP组控制动态路由开销值2.VGMP

开启双机热备功能后,防火墙能根据VGMP组状态动态调整OSPF/OSPFv3发布路由的开销值和BGP发布路由的MED值。具体如下:

VGMP组状态为Load-balance时,防火墙默认按照OSPF/OSPFv3/BGP路由的配置正常发布路由。如果用户在防火墙上配置了“hrpstandby-device”命令指定防火墙为备份设备或者将防火墙的所有VRRP备份组状态参数都配置为Standby,则防火墙会调整OSPF/OSPFv3发布路由的开销值和BGP发布路由的MED值,调整的方法与VGMP组状态为Standby时相同。双机热备的工作原理02(3)VGMP组控制动态路由开销值3.HRP

HRP提供了基础的数据备份机制和传输功能,用来实现防火墙双机之间状态数据和关键配置命令的动态备份。

备份内容(1)设备配置:策略、对象、网络、系统等。(2)状态信息:会话表、Server-map表、黑白名单、地址映射表、MAC地址表、用户表、IPSec安全联盟和隧道等。双机热备的工作原理023.HRP

HRP提供了基础的数据备份机制和传输功能,用来实现防火墙双机之间状态数据和关键配置命令的动态备份。

备份方向支持备份的配置命令默认只能在主设备上执行,这些命令会自动备份到备设备上。例如,安全策略配置命令、NAT策略配置命令等;主备备份组网中,只有主设备会处理业务,主设备上生成业务表项,并向备设备备份。负载分担组网中,两台防火墙都会处理业务,都会生成业务表项并向对端设备备份。

备份通道配置和状态数据需要网络管理员指定备份通道接口进行备份。一般情况下,在两台设备上直连的端口作为备份通道,有时也称为“心跳线”(VGMP也通过该通道进行通信)。双机热备的工作原理023.HRP双机热备的工作原理02备份方式自动备份:缺省为开启状态,能够自动实时备份配置命令和周期性地备份状态信息,适用于各种双机热备组网。手工批量备份:需要管理员手工触发,每执行一次手工批量备份命令,主用设备就会立即同步一次配置命令和状态信息到备用设备。设备重启主备防火墙的配置自动同步:重启成功的设备会自动从当前承载业务的防火墙上进行一次配置同步。会话快速备份:会话快速备份功能,适用于负载分担的工作方式,以应对报文来回路径不一致的场景。备份内容设备配置:策略:安全策略、NAT策略、认证策略、攻击防范和ASPF等;对象:地址、地区、服务、应用、用户、认证服务器、时间段、地址池、URL分类、关键字组、邮件地址组、签名和安全配置文件等;网络:新建逻辑接口、安全区域、DNS、静态路由(配置hrpauto-syncconfigstatic-route后才可以备份)、IPSec和SSLVPN等;系统:管理员、虚拟系统、日志配置等。状态信息:会话表、Sever-map表、黑白名单、地址映射表、MAC表、用户表、IPSec安全联盟和隧道等。4.心跳线

心跳线是两台防火墙交互消息了解对端状态、备份配置命令和各种表项的通道。心跳线两端的接口通常称为心跳接口。在双机热备组网中,两台防火墙之间备份的数据是通过防火墙的心跳接口发送和接收的,通过心跳线传输。心跳接口可以是一个物理接口,也可以是多个物理接口捆绑成的一个逻辑接口(Eth-Trunk接口)。双机热备的工作原理024.心跳线

心跳线主要传递如下消息。

心跳报文(Hello报文):两台防火墙通过固定周期(默认周期为1s)互相发送心跳报文,检测对端设备是否存活。

VGMP报文:了解对端设备的VGMP组状态,确定本端和对端设备的当前状态是否稳定,以及是否进行故障切换。

配置和表项备份报文:用于两台防火墙之间同步配置命令和状态信息。

心跳链路探测报文:用于检测对端设备的心跳接口能否正常接收本端设备的报文,确定是否有心跳接口可以使用。

配置一致性检查报文:用于检测两台防火墙的关键配置是否一致,如安全策略、NAT策略等。双机热备的工作原理02(1)传递的报文4.心跳线HRP的心跳接口共有6种状态:Invalid、Down、Peerdown、Negotiation

failed、Ready、Running。双机热备的工作原理02(2)心跳接口状态4.心跳线Invalid:当本端防火墙上的心跳口配置错误时显示此状态(物理状态up,协议状态down);Down:当本端防火墙上的心跳口的物理与协议状态均为down时,则会显示此状态;Peerdown:本端防火墙上的心跳接口的物理状态与协议状态均为Up时,如果收不到对端响应的报文,那么会将自己的心跳接口状态设置为Peerdown。NegotiationFailed:当本端和对端设备协商主备状态失败时显示此状态;Ready:当本端防火墙上的心跳口的物理与协议状态均为up时,则心跳口会向对端对应的心跳口发送心跳链路探测报文;Running:当本端防火墙有多个处于Ready状态的心跳口时,防火墙会选择最先配置的心跳口形成心跳链路,并设置此心跳口的状态为Running。双机热备的工作原理02(2)心跳接口状态03双机热备的组网模型1.基于VRRP的双机热备双机热备的组网模型03(1)基于VRRP实现主备备份的双机热备

如图所示,防火墙A的所有VRRP备份组均配置为Active状态,防火墙B的所有VRRP备份组均配置为Standby状态。在正常情况下,两台防火墙的VGMP组状态均为Load-balance,VRRP备份组的具体运行状态由配置决定。此时,双机热备采用主备备份的组网模式。1.基于VRRP的双机热备双机热备的组网模型03(1)基于VRRP实现主备备份的双机热备

如图所示,当防火墙A的上行业务接口出现故障时,其VRRP备份组1的状态变为Initialize。同时,防火墙A和防火墙B的VGMP组状态随之发生了变化,防火墙A的VGMP组状态变为Standby,而防火墙B的VGMP组状态变为Active。1.基于VRRP的双机热备双机热备的组网模型03(2)基于VRRP实现负载分担的双机热备

如图所示,防火墙A的VRRP备份组1和备份组3状态被配置成Active,VRRP备份组2和备份组4状态被配置成Standby。防火墙B的VRRP备份组2和备份组4状态被配置成Active,VRRP备份组1和备份组3状态被配置成Standby。正常情况下,两台防火墙的VGMP组状态都是Load-balance,VRRP备份组的状态由配置决定。1.基于VRRP的双机热备双机热备的组网模型03(2)基于VRRP实现负载分担的双机热备

因此,防火墙A的VRRP备份组1和VRRP备份组3状态是Master,VRRP备份组2和VRRP备份组4状态是Backup;防火墙B的VRRP备份组2和VRRP备份组4状态是Master,VRRP备份组1和VRRP备份组3状态是Backup。此时,防火墙双机热备采用负载分担的组网模式。1.基于VRRP的双机热备双机热备的组网模型03(2)基于VRRP实现负载分担的双机热备

如图所示,当防火墙A的上行业务接口出现故障时,其VRRP备份组1和VRRP备份组2的状态变为Initialize。同时,防火墙A和防火墙B的VGMP组状态随之发生了变化:防火墙A的VGMP组状态变为Standby,而防火墙B的VGMP组状态变为Active。2.基于动态路由的双机热备双机热备的组网模型03(1)基于动态路由实现主备备份的双机热备

如图所示,将防火墙B设定为备份设备。当两台防火墙均正常工作时,防火墙A会按照OSPF协议的配置正常发布路由信息,而防火墙B发布的OSPF路由的开销值会被调整为65500。由于防火墙A所在链路的开销值远小于防火墙B所在链路的开销值,而路由器在转发流量时会选择开销值更小的路径,因此内外网之间的流量都会被引导到防火墙A上进行处理。2.基于动态路由的双机热备双机热备的组网模型03(1)基于动态路由实现主备备份的双机热备

如图所示,当防火墙A的上行业务接口出现故障时,其VGMP组状态变为Standby,而防火墙B的VGMP组状态变为Active。随后,防火墙A和防火墙B根据VGMP组的状态对OSPF协议的路由开销值进行相应调整:防火墙A发布的OSPF路由开销值被调整为65500,而防火墙B发布的OSPF路由开销值被调整为1。路由完成收敛后,内外网之间的流量都被引导到防火墙B上进行处理。2.基于动态路由的双机热备双机热备的组网模型03(2)基于动态路由实现负载分担的双机热备

如图所示,若要使两台防火墙形成负载分担组网,则需在防火墙及上下行路由器上合理配置OSPF协议的路由开销值,以确保流量能均匀分配到两台防火墙上进行处理。例如,可将防火墙和路由器的OSPF路由开销值均设置为默认值1。这样,在两台防火墙均正常工作时,防火墙A和防火墙B所在链路的开销值相等,内外网之间的流量将由防火墙A和防火墙B共同负载。2.基于动态路由的双机热备双机热备的组网模型03(2)基于动态路由实现负载分担的双机热备

如图所示,当防火墙A的上行业务接口出现故障时,其VGMP组状态变为Standby,而防火墙B的VGMP组状态变为Active。此时,防火墙A和防火墙B会根据VGMP组的状态对OSPF协议的路由开销值进行调整:防火墙A

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论